I heard you should not sit them upright. Anybody knows why? Is the bouncer ok?

you are not supposed to sit the upright for one as their heads are so large they cannot hold them up and will fall forward perhaps injuringing themselves, a bouncer or car chair etc, is ok as they are usually in a reclined position and this is fine.
